Researchers from the California Institute of Technology (Caltech) have developed a wireless smart capsule packed with sensors and other tiny electronics to monitor the workings of your gastrointestinal (GI) tract. Professor Wei Gao noted that PillTrek was designed "to be a very versatile platform," in the sense that a variety of sensors can be swapped into it depending on what you want to monitor in a patient's gut. "Ingestible capsules have significant potential in diagnosis, monitoring, and management of chronic conditions, but previous devices were very limited in terms of their sensing capabilities, lifetime, and size," noted Azita Emami, a co-author on the paper detailing PillTrek that appeared in Nature Electronics last month.
